## Loading Dock — Delivery Hours (Thornfield Building)

The loading dock accepts deliveries 06:30–11:00 and 14:00–16:30 on weekdays. Outside these windows the roller shutter stays locked and couriers must be turned away — no exceptions without a warden present. Facilities desk staff should log every delivery in the dock register, including pallet counts and any damage noted at handover. Oversized deliveries need a booking one day in advance. If the shutter fails to respond to a badge swipe, use the manual keypad with the code below.

staff pass of kawip-hawef = bdg-QLP-2

Subject: Partner SFTP drop — new owner

Hi,

As you review the pending changes to the Harborline ingest scripts, note that ownership of the partner SFTP drop is changing at the end of the month. This includes key rotation, the nightly pull job, and the quarantine folder for malformed files. Review comments on the retry logic should still go through the normal PR flow, but questions about drop-folder conventions or partner onboarding now go to the new owner. The incoming owner is listed below.

signatory, tagaf-bahaf: Praael Fenmir Rusok

# Break-Glass: Catalog Cache Invalidation

Scope: the Pinrow product catalog at Veldstone Retail. If stale prices persist after a purge and the Hollowmere invalidation queue is wedged, use break-glass to flush the edge tier directly. Contractors: get verbal sign-off from the catalog lead first. Steps: open the Hollowmere admin shell, select emergency-flush, confirm the tenant, and run it once — repeated flushes thrash the origin. Access is logged and expires after 20 minutes. Unseal the admin shell with the passphrase below.

recovery phrase for kahop-tajog: istix-casvan

- [ ] **Step 7: Breaker override escrow.** After sealing the signing keys for the Tallgrove upstream API circuit breaker, confirm the support team can force the breaker open during a full outage. The override bundle lives in the sealed escrow drawer and is useless without its unlock phrase. Two ceremony witnesses must initial this step before proceeding. The escrow bundle is decrypted with the recovery passphrase that follows.

vault phrase of kahip-kahop = holath-quenmir